Can you still use iPad 2nd Gen?

An iPad 2 lacks the hardware required to run newer iOS versions and, if you need more function than the iPad 2 can provide, yourneed a new iPad. iPad2, iPad3 and iPad mini1 can only be updated to iOS 9.3. 5 (WiFi Only models) or iOS 9.3. 6 (WiFi & Cellular models).

How old is iPad MC769LL A?

MC769LL/A / iPad2,1 / A1395
The iPad 2 (WiFi) – MC769LL/A was released in 2011 and features a 9.7″ display, a Black housing, and 16GB of storage. The device was released on March 2nd 2011 with a MSRP of $499. Overall dimensions are 9.50 x 7.31 x 0.34 inches with a weight of approximately 1.33 lbs.

Can I get money for my old iPad?

Apple GiveBack
The company will pay up to $250 for your old iPad in the form of an Apple gift card. Unlike when trading in an iPhone, Apple requires you to share the serial number of the iPad to see the trade-in value. It will also ask you to share information about the condition of the device.

How long does a iPad last?

How Many Years Should an iPad Last? Apple usually supports a new iPad with iPadOS updates for at least five years and often several years longer. Most iPad models hold up well in performance, features, and storage over this timeframe which means that five years is a standard lifespan for any iPad.

What iPads Cannot be updated?

1. The iPad 2, iPad 3, and iPad Mini cannot be upgraded past iOS 9.3. 5. The iPad 4 does not support updates past iOS 10.3.

Why can’t I update my iPad to iOS 15?

You might be unable to update your iPhone or iPad wirelessly — or over the air — for one of these reasons: Your device doesn’t support the latest software. There isn’t enough available storage space on your device. The update takes a long time to download.
